Danny Williamson is the first athlete elected to the LETR Leadership Council for Special Olympics MA, a historic milestone highlighting inclusion and athlete leadership in shaping the movement's future.
Jenny Price launched a walking club in Walpole, MA, for Special Olympics athletes, boosting community, physical and mental health, and friendships. With a waitlist growing, it promotes healthy habits and inspires similar initiatives.
On Wednesday, March 27th, Special Olympics Massachusetts athletes, community members, and staff headed to the State House to thank Rep. Garballey and other State Senators and Representatives who have demonstrated ongoing support.

Peter Kline formed “Marathons With Meaning” to make running more accessible for individuals with disabilities. This year, Peter will run the Boston Marathon with Natick High School Unified Track athlete Yousef.
The New England PGA professionals were impressed with Special Olympics MA Athlete, Tyler Lagasse as he drove a beautiful ceremonial tee shot right down the fairway and asked him to join in on the action for the final round.
Mark Casey coaches the Dorchester Blue Devils basketball team, where he promotes inclusivity and works to expand Special Olympics programs in and around Boston.
